If you’re looking into home battery backup right now, you’re almost certainly looking at lithium-ion. It’s the industry default. But behind the scenes, lithium has two stubborn problems for homeowners: raw material costs fluctuate wildly, and there's always that lingering anxiety about fire risk.
Sodium-ion is quietly stepping up as a serious alternative. We decided to run the math on a standard 10kWh home setup, and the long-term economics actually surprised us.
Here is why sodium might be the smarter play for your house:
1. You can stop worrying about fires. Lithium batteries—specifically NMC chemistries—carry a small but real risk of thermal runaway. If they overheat, they can catch fire. Sodium-ion is inherently stable. You could practically drive a nail through a sodium cell without it bursting into flames. When you’re bolting a massive battery to the side of your house where your family sleeps, that peace of mind is huge.
2. It actually works when it’s freezing. If you live in a cold climate, lithium batteries can be frustrating; their capacity tanks when the temperature drops below freezing. Sodium-ion doesn't flinch in sub-zero temperatures. That means when a winter storm knocks out the grid—exactly when you need backup power the most—your battery will actually deliver.
3. The math gets better every year. Lithium still wins on energy density (packing more power into a smaller box). But for a house, saving a few inches of wall space doesn't matter nearly as much as it does in an electric car. Sodium is made from materials you can find anywhere, meaning it’s immune to global supply chain drama. Once manufacturing scales up over the next few years, sodium is poised to drastically undercut lithium on price.
